What Are Tilt and Turn Windows?
Tilt and turn windows are a special kind of window that can be run in two unique methods: tilting inward for ventilation or turning completely open to provide a larger entrance. This double performance makes them ideal for various architectural styles and environments, including both practicality and sophistication to homes.

Boosted Ventilation
Tilt and turn windows provide exceptional ventilation choices. The tilted position permits fresh air to flow without completely opening the window, making them perfect for locations where security or kids is an issue.
2. Space-Saving
Given that these windows open inward, they do not need extra space outside for motion, making them perfect for verandas or narrow paths.
3. Ease of Cleaning
As these windows open inward, cleaning the exterior surface areas becomes a hassle-free job. This is especially advantageous for multi-story structures where cleaning can be tough.
4. Improved Security
The dual-locking mechanism available in tilt and turn windows supplies boosted security compared to standard window styles. House owners can feel safeguarded knowing that the windows are robust and safe.
5. Energy Efficiency

Drawbacks to Consider
While tilt and turn windows included many advantages, potential purchasers need to likewise think about some downsides:
1. Higher Initial Cost
The advanced style and performance of tilt and turn windows might suggest a greater initial price compared to standard window designs.
2. Complex Mechanism
The mechanical parts can be more complex than standard Window Installation Specialists styles, which may need Professional Window Installers installation and maintenance.
3. Restricted Style Options
Although these windows are versatile, the offered design alternatives may not fit every aesthetic preference or architectural design.
